Christmas Tree Give-away From TROSA

DURHAM, N.C. – Triangle Residential Options for Substance Abusers (TROSA) plans to give away Christmas trees to those who can’t afford a tree on Sunday, December 23. For the past few weeks, TROSA has been selling the trees and wreaths as part of their annual fundraiser to raise money to cover costs of their two-year, comprehensive treatment program.

The Tree Give-Away is being offered as a way to help other families in the Durham community who can not afford to purchase a tree for their homes. Trees will be available at the following TROSA Christmas tree lot locations in Durham: 4215 University Drive – Kmart parking lot, 3301 Hillsborough Road – Advance Auto Parts parking lot, Northgate Mall, and The Streets at Southpoint (Grassy area beside Southpoint Cinemas). Donations are requested from those who can afford a tree.

TROSA is a non-profit, two-year residential program serving persons who have addictions to drugs or alcohol. Founded in Durham in 1994, TROSA has steadily grown and is now the largest therapeutic community in North Carolina, currently serving over 400 people. For more information, visit www.trosainc.org .
